我是 jQuery 和 jQuery UI 的新手。我正在尝试将 div 从父 div 移动到另一个。到目前为止,我的“文章”是可拖动的。“可放置”库存在文章上方移动时正确识别它,但我似乎无法找到如何将这篇文章附加到库存。
我想我正在操作一个“封装在 jQuery 对象中的 div”,但我在这里有点迷失了。
<div id="shelf" class="shelf">
<div class="article">article</div>
</div>
<div id="stock" class="stock">
</div>
然后我有一个脚本,旨在将文章添加到 stock div,并将其从货架 div 中删除:
<script>
$('.article').draggable();
var stockArea = $('#stock').droppable();
stockArea.bind( "drop", function(event, ui) {
if ($(this).find(".article")){
console.log('appending ' + ui);
$(this).append(ui);
}
});
</script>
我做错了吗?谢谢,